STE 32MHz PLUG IN BOOSTER (again) 2021 variation
Posted: 11 Jan 2021 19:53
OK, So I couldn't leave this alone.. So after the bit of a epic load of drama over on the previous design https://www.exxosforum.co.uk/forum/viewt ... 1018#p7645 I designed this variation...
This is still a plug-in board. It plugs "inside" the 68K CPU socket as not to damage the socket. I have some dummy squares but may need tweaking to fit.
This one has SMT bus pullups (no need to solder them anymore! yay!) , so no need to change them on the motherboard either. They have always been on the V1 series, but in SIP format. Now I can get stuff assembled (at least in part) I went with SMT resistors packs.
The whole thing pretty much got re-designed. Mostly it worked fine anyway, but internal and external blitter machines were causing huge headaches and needed different fixes depending on what machine they were fitted in. Which ultimately lead to the project being abandoned. This time it has a schmitt buffer and a lot of small tweaks on the PCB and firmware. So I *hope* this will actually fix those issues..
